  • totalnew
    replied
    1. There is an excutable file "maq2sam" come with samtools package to allow you convert maq out to sam format.

    2. For FLAG field, if you want to parse it, simply use $FLAG & 0x01(02, 20, 20..) to determine the meaning of the FLAG bits.

    started a topic Maq output to SAM format

    Maq output to SAM format

    1> I have been using MAQ for a while. Now I would like to move on the BWA. Is there any convinent method to convert a MAQ output (.map) to SAM format so to ease comparison between MAQ and BWA?

    2> Regarding the SAM format output by BWA, there is a <flag> column. I read from the manual that it's a bitwise flag. But in my BWA output I get numeric value, (e.g. 83, 99, 163, etc). How can I interpret the result?
